BACKGROUND: Radio-frequency (RF) needle beauty instrument is a kind of new digital medical equipment that achieves the cosmetic results through the micro-needle technology to transfer RF energy. Because of the excellent safety and efficacy, the embedded design has been widely favored.OBJECTIVE: To design an embedded RF electro-acupuncture beauty instrument.METHODS: The system was based on embedded ARM-WinCE, the controller of the system was STM32F103 processor, and Windows CE was used as GUI development tool.RESULTS AND CONCLUSION: The embedded RF electro-acupuncture beauty instrument can provide the RF energy output and provide visual signals for human-computer interaction through the liquid crystal display screen. The results proved that the system has a small size, high reliability, low cost, excellent human-computer interaction ability.关键词
